HueHue

Open source LED controler App for Windows, Arduinos and various RGB Devices

HueHue is a simple LED controler based on Arduino and open-source libraries aimed for PC cases, tables, decoration and any place where you want to put Windows PC-controled LED kits. This has some resemblance to established PC case manufacturers functionality for LED control.

What can it do:

  • Real time controled fixed colors.
  • Infinitely Alternate colors.
  • Breathing effects.
  • Rainbow color effects completely customizable by the user.
  • Realtime music reactive color based on the default Windows audio device.
  • "Snake" colors.
  • Basic control of Razer Chroma devices using the Chroma SDK.

All featuring very low CPU usage, Even on audio processing modes, no fake "Cloud" computing, no data mining, no keyboard logging and etc.

Unfortunately, you do need to install each and every SDK related to your devices.

What it will do:

  • CPU, GPU Temperature reactive colors.
  • "Flu.x" like color effects to help reduce eye strain overnight.
  • Better UI and user experience, with auto updating and etc.
  • Sync effects with existing RGB hardware including Corsair, Logitech and Razer keyboards and mouses, or even Philips Hue Lights.
  • Auto change effects when a determined software starts running

What it will do maybe:

  • Sync lights with games
  • Scripting mode where you can program a effect manualy.

This may prove tricky, but since the core use of Arduino... what about attempting RGB control of the OLD Thermaltake Riing fans?

Hey, I mentioned this over on DarthAffe's Git... (Also, I should come clean; I'm actually a degreed Electrical Engineer btw not software haha). But EE's do just as much coding anyways.

I know TT Premium is around, not sure on what their status is for an SDK.

But for those of us BLESSEDDDDD with having purchased SEVEN [7] (if you can't sense my frustration) of the old-school Thermaltake Riing fans a couple months before TT Premium became a rumor... it'd be an awesome feature to be able to convert those pesky Button-Controlled fans into imitating their newer SW-controlled "Premium" versions. Since HueHue already has Arduino as essential machinery (or at least that's the plan) to make the project work; now would seem like a perfect opportunity to use the onboard GPIO pins and a simple circuit tied/soldered into the Thermaltake control boxes, to essentially turn the manual-controlled fans into smart-RGB-controlled. It may be something as simple as soldering a jumper wire to the pushbutton on the fan controller circuit board. Then you would just have to write some routines to mimic as many RGB Effects as possible.
